From Death Records of Outagamie County, Wisconsin - Vol 3 (Pre Oct 1907)
Certificate No 90 (01135)
- Full name of deceased = Annie Mailahn
- Maiden name (if wife or widow), = (blank)
- Color and sex, = White . Female
- Race, = Caucasian
- Occupation of deceased = Housework
- Age (years, months and days), = 25 years, 7 mo, 16 dys
- Name of father, = Louis Mailahn
- Birthplace of father = Germany
- Name of mother, = Gustie Schmidt
- Birthplace of mother = Wisconsin
- Birthplace of deceased = Town Black Creek
- Date of birth of deceased = July 20 - 1820 [note, year 1820 is clearly a clarical error, was 1880]
- Condition (single, married, widowed, or divorced, = Single
- Name of wife or husband of deceased = (blank)
- Date of death, = Mar. 16. 1906
- Cause of Death {Primary, Secondary} = Phthisis Pulmonalis (Consumption) Heart Failure
- Duration of disease = One year
- Place of death = At home
- Residence at time of death = Town Center
- Was deceased ever a U. S. solider or sailor? = (blank)
- Name of physician, coroner or justice, = E. N. Lartell M.D.
- Residenc of such person = Black Creek, Wis.
- Name of undertaker or other person conducting burial = Rev. Hinnenthal
- No. and date of burial permit = 11 - March 17th 1906
- Place of burial = Town Cemetery Black Creek
- Date of certificate = March 18th 1906
- Date of registration = March 21st 1906
- Other important facts not related = (blank)
